To support the open source community, which may want to use different analytics services, we implement a soy template for analytics services that:
1) Does not require users to implement Google Analytics
2) Allows users to add their own analytics code to `Analytics.soy`
3) Gives users the flexibility to pass as much or as little static configuration to their custom analytics code as needed.
4) Ensures that users can merge upstream Nomulus code in the future without having to delete their custom analytics implementations
5) Does not allow code to be injected from configuration, which Soy as a framework actively discourages.

This console is only to be used by Admins (either GAE admins for this project, or Support accounts). It is for "internal" use only, not for use by the registrars themselves.
To prevent abuse, the registrar is created in a non-functional PENDING state and can only be made functional from the nomulus shell tool.
While in "PENDING" state, the registrar can be updated from the registrar-console by admins.
